GBP Resilience Faces Critical Threat from Energy Vulnerability – MUFG Analysis Reveals
The British Pound’s recent period of stability faces mounting pressure as structural energy vulnerabilities threaten to undermine its hard-won resilience, according to fresh analysis from MUFG. London, March 2025 – Currency markets now closely monitor the intersection of energy security and monetary strength.
Market analysts observe the Pound’s performance with increasing scrutiny. Furthermore, the currency demonstrated notable stability through early 2025. However, underlying energy dependencies create significant exposure. Consequently, MUFG researchers highlight this critical vulnerability in their latest assessment.
The United Kingdom’s energy profile presents complex challenges. Specifically, the nation imports approximately 40% of its total energy needs. Additionally, natural gas constitutes nearly 40% of electricity generation. Therefore, international price fluctuations directly impact domestic stability. Meanwhile, renewable expansion continues but faces integration hurdles.
Several factors contribute to Britain’s energy exposure. First, declining North Sea production increases import dependence. Second, limited gas storage capacity reduces buffer capabilities. Third, interconnected European markets transmit price volatility. Fourth, weather-dependent renewables require backup generation.

These structural characteristics create persistent challenges. Moreover, geopolitical tensions amplify existing risks. Consequently, currency markets price in these vulnerabilities through risk premiums.
MUFG economists employ sophisticated modeling techniques. Specifically, they correlate energy metrics with currency performance. Their research identifies clear transmission mechanisms. For instance, energy price shocks typically precede currency depreciation. Additionally, balance of payments pressures emerge from import costs.
The analysis reveals several concerning patterns. First, each 10% increase in wholesale gas prices correlates with 0.3% GBP depreciation. Second, storage levels below 50% capacity increase volatility expectations. Third, interconnector disruptions immediately affect market sentiment. Fourth, policy uncertainty compounds these technical factors.
Historical data supports these conclusions. Notably, the 2022 energy crisis saw GBP decline 15% against the dollar. Similarly, winter 2023 supply concerns triggered sharp selloffs. Therefore, current resilience appears fragile against recurring patterns.
Energy vulnerabilities affect sterling through multiple pathways. Primarily, trade balance deterioration pressures the currency. Specifically, higher import bills widen current account deficits. Subsequently, foreign investors demand higher risk compensation. Meanwhile, inflation expectations influence interest rate projections.
The Bank of England faces complex policy trade-offs. On one hand, energy-driven inflation requires monetary response. On the other hand, economic fragility limits tightening capacity. Consequently, policy uncertainty increases market volatility. Furthermore, investor confidence becomes increasingly sensitive to energy developments.

These interconnected mechanisms create amplification effects. Additionally, feedback loops between channels accelerate adjustments. Therefore, isolated energy incidents can trigger disproportionate currency responses.
Britain’s energy position differs significantly from peers. For example, the United States achieves energy independence through shale production. Similarly, Norway maintains substantial hydrocarbon exports. Meanwhile, France relies on nuclear power for energy security.
These structural differences create relative advantages. Specifically, the US dollar benefits from domestic energy abundance. Consequently, it often strengthens during global energy crises. Conversely, the euro demonstrates mixed performance across member states. However, collective EU mechanisms provide some insulation.
The Pound occupies a middle position in this spectrum. It lacks both US-style independence and EU-scale coordination. Therefore, it remains particularly exposed to international market dynamics. This exposure manifests in heightened volatility during supply disruptions.
UK authorities recognize these vulnerabilities and pursue multiple initiatives. The Energy Security Strategy outlines comprehensive measures. Investment in renewable generation accelerates significantly. Additionally, nuclear power projects receive renewed emphasis. Meanwhile, energy efficiency programs target demand reduction.
Market mechanisms also undergo reform. Capacity market auctions ensure reliable supply. Furthermore, interconnection projects enhance European integration. Storage facilities receive regulatory support for expansion. However, implementation timelines extend several years.
Short-term measures include strategic reserves and price controls. These interventions provide temporary relief. Nevertheless, they cannot address structural dependencies. Consequently, currency markets discount their long-term effectiveness. Market participants instead focus on fundamental supply-demand balances.
The British Pound’s resilience faces genuine threats from energy vulnerabilities. MUFG analysis clearly identifies transmission mechanisms and risk factors. Structural dependencies create persistent exposure to international markets. Therefore, sustained GBP strength requires addressing these fundamental challenges. Energy security and currency stability remain inextricably linked for the UK economy.
Q1: How does energy vulnerability specifically affect the British Pound?
Energy vulnerability affects GBP through multiple channels: higher import costs worsen the trade balance, energy-driven inflation influences Bank of England policy, and security concerns reduce investor confidence, all contributing to currency pressure.
Q2: What percentage of UK energy is imported?
The United Kingdom currently imports approximately 40% of its total energy needs, with natural gas import dependency around 55% of supply, creating significant exposure to international price fluctuations.
Q3: How does MUFG measure the relationship between energy prices and GBP?
MUFG economists use correlation analysis showing each 10% increase in wholesale gas prices typically correlates with 0.3% GBP depreciation, with stronger effects during supply disruptions or storage shortages.
Q4: What makes the UK particularly vulnerable compared to other economies?
The UK occupies a middle position between energy-independent nations like the US and coordinated blocs like the EU, lacking both domestic abundance and collective mechanisms, while having limited storage capacity and high import dependence.
Q5: What policy measures could strengthen GBP against energy risks?
Key measures include accelerating renewable deployment, expanding nuclear capacity, increasing storage infrastructure, enhancing European interconnections, and improving energy efficiency to reduce overall import dependency.
